Valeisha Butterfield Jones graduated from Clark Atlanta University with a degree in Political Science. After college, Butterfield Jones had a job offer as the Executive Assistant for the President of HBO Sports. “I was coordinating matches at Caesar’s Palace,” Butterfield Jones stated from her book. 

Furthermore, she was an intern for Entrepreneur Mogul Russell Simmons. The opportunity led Butterfield Jones as the Executive Vice President of Rush Communications. As she continues her road of success, Butterfield Jones landed a volunteer job for then-Senator Barack Obama. Assisted in campaigning his run as the next 44th President of the United States. Butterfield Jones co-founded, and was the CEO of Women in Entertainment Empowerment Network (WEEN). A non-profit organization that focused on leadership and innovation for the next generation of women within the entertainment, media, and tech industries. Butterfield Jones was also the National Director of Diversity and Inclusion for Alzheimer’s Association. Nothing has stopped her there!

Making an Impact For Many People

In 2009, Butterfield Jones had a chance of a lifetime, to work with the Obama Administration as the Deputy Director of Public Affairs. She also helped the former President with the re-election campaign as the National Youth Vote Director. “The position was a dream opportunity for me. I got to spend time engaging young people, promoting awareness of the political process…,” Butterfield Jones stated from her book.

The marketing and communications strategist, and North Carolina native had made many career moves that helped her to be at the top of many industries. With so many years of experience, Valeisha holds her daily Mast(Her)ed (now SEED) webinars for professionals, college students, and new career dreamers. This program helps many to gain a strategic mindset, and to be inspired for the next opportunities.
